- Что такое «файл настроек конфигурации» в СБИС для 1С
- Самые частые причины, почему «не установлен файл настроек конфигурации 1с»
- Как исправить: проверка настроек и автообновление
- Если автообновление не помогло: обновите именно “под вашу конфигурацию”
- Если проблема всплывает после обновления конфигурации 1С
- Что проверить, если в протоколе именно “не найден файл настроек конфигурации”
- Если конфигурация сильно доработана: почему типовые файлы могут не подойти
- Рекомендуемый порядок действий, если вы видите “не установлен файл настроек конфигурации”
- Куда смотреть, если всё равно не получается
- Источники
Не установлен файл настроек конфигурации 1С СБИС: как исправить и почему это происходит
Если во внешней обработке СБИС в момент работы появляется протокол вида «не найден файл настроек конфигурации 1с» или «не установлен файл настроек конфигурации», дело почти всегда в том, что обработка не смогла подобрать нужную настройка под вашу документ-логику и версию 1С. Чаще всего проблема сводится к тому, что не подтянулся нужный набор файл настроек конфигурации (ini/xml), либо он пришёл в неподходящей версии для вашей базы.
Ниже - что проверить по шагам и как довести до «Ошибок в ini-файлах не обнаружено».
Что такое «файл настроек конфигурации» в СБИС для 1С
Во внешней обработке СБИС используются XML файл-ы настроек, которые содержат типовые настройки под конкретные конфигурации 1С и описывают, какие данные и как обрабатываются.
Ключевой момент: для каждой конфигурации 1С есть свой набор файлов, и среди них есть отдельный файл с настройка конфигурации.
По маске его имя выглядит так:
| Тип файла | Маска имени |
|---|---|
| настройка конфигурации | ВО82<Код конфигурации>_Конфигурация.sbis3.xml |
Эта настройка задаёт базовые параметры работы обработки. Если её нет или версия не совпадает - дальше начинают «сыпаться» проверки остальных ini/XML, и в итоге обработка может не показывать разделы, не проходить по разделам или блокировать работу.
Самые частые причины, почему «не установлен файл настроек конфигурации 1с»
Ниже причины, которые обычно лежат в основе протокола проверки установленных ini-файлов.
| Причина | Как проявляется | Что обычно делают |
|---|---|---|
| Конфигурация 1С не поддерживается внешней обработкой | Протокол ошибок и блокировка разделов | Берут корректный набор настроек для поддерживаемой конфигурации |
| 1С обновили, а настройки внешней обработки остались старые | Ошибка после обновления 1С | Включают автообновление и запускают «Проверка настроек» |
| Версия файлов настроек отличается от версии конфигурации | Ошибки именно в ini-файлах/в протоколе | Подбирают последнюю настройку под текущую версию 1С и обновляют |
Важно понимать: если вы меняли конфигурацию или обновляли платформу/редакцию, набор ini/xml для «старой» версии может перестать подходить. Тогда обработка говорит, что нужная настройка не установлена или не проходит проверку.
Как исправить: проверка настроек и автообновление
Шаг 1. Откройте раздел с проверкой ini-файлов
Внешняя обработка СБИС обычно показывает окно «протокол проверки установленных ini-файлов», где перечислены ошибки. Дальше ориентируйтесь на рекомендации из протокола и на следующую логику.
Шаг 2. Включите автообновление и запустите проверку
Сделайте так, чтобы обработка подтянула актуальные XML/ini под вашу текущую базу 1С.
| Что нажать | Для чего |
|---|---|
| Включить флаг Автообновление | чтобы обработка подгрузила актуальный набор файлов |
| Нажать Проверка настроек | чтобы подтвердить, что файлы ini/xml подходят по версии |
Если после этого в протоколе появляется строка вроде «Ошибок в ini-файлах не обнаружено», значит, настройка конфигурации подтянулась корректно.
Если автообновление не помогло: обновите именно “под вашу конфигурацию”
Иногда обработка автообновляет не тот набор или у вас не выбран нужный вариант файла настроек под конкретную редакцию/версию.
Шаг 3. Проверьте выбранные конфигурации в обработке
Откройте меню в обработке в части настроек файлов, где выбирается конфигурация (обычно это что-то вроде «Настройки/Файлы настроек»).
Дальше работает принцип: берём подходящую последнюю конфигурацию для вашей версии 1С и перезапускаем проверку.
| Действие | Зачем |
|---|---|
| выбрать конфигурацию из списка, соответствующую вашей 1С | чтобы файл …_Конфигурация.sbis3.xml совпал по версии/подсистеме |
| создать новое подключение/выбранные настройки по кнопке, которая делает “новое подключение” | чтобы не остаться со старым набором |
| нажать стрелку/установку всех настроек (если такой шаг есть) | чтобы подтянуть нужные файлы целиком |
| снова запустить Проверка настроек | проверить, что ошибок больше нет |
Если проблема всплывает после обновления конфигурации 1С
Это классический сценарий из практики: сначала обновили УТ/ERP/Бухгалтерию/платформу, потом открыли внешнюю обработку СБИС - и сразу пошёл протокол ошибок.
По логике СБИС, версии файлов настроек и версия конфигурации должны быть согласованы. Поэтому алгоритм простой:
| Было сделано | Должно быть сделано в СБИС |
|---|---|
| обновили конфигурацию 1С | включить автообновление и повторить проверку |
| изменили/доработали конфигурацию | проверить, что набор типовых ini/xml подходит, иначе понадобится корректировка |
| переустанавливали платформу/очищали кэш | проверить, что обработка корректно сохранила ConnectionID и подтягивает нужные файлы |
Что проверить, если в протоколе именно “не найден файл настроек конфигурации”
Тут полезно мыслить от имени файла и от привязки к версии.
Шаг 4. Убедитесь, что “настройка конфигурации” присутствует в системе обработки
Ориентир по маске:
ВО82<Код конфигурации>_Конфигурация.sbis3.xml
Если ваша конфигурация не соответствует коду/версии, обработка не сможет использовать файл и будет жаловаться, что файл настроек конфигурации не установлен/не найден.
Шаг 5. Проверьте, что подходящий набор хранится и распакован корректно
В зависимости от способа обмена настройка может храниться:
- в каталоге на диске (для некоторых сценариев),
- или в СБИС, а в локальную папку распаковывается при запуске.
Для клиент-серверной схемы папка может располагаться на сервере. Если вы “не видите” файлы на рабочей станции, это ещё не значит, что их нет в нужном месте.
Если конфигурация сильно доработана: почему типовые файлы могут не подойти
СБИС использует стандартные файлы настроек, но если ваша 1С сильно изменена, типовые ini/xml могут не совпасть по структуре и тогда автоматическая проверка всё равно покажет ошибки.
В такой ситуации обычно применяют пользовательские настройки:
- создают/правят пользовательские XML-файлы,
- и они накладываются поверх стандартных.
Идея такая: стандартные файлы обновляются с обработкой, а ваши изменения хранятся отдельно и “перекрывают” стандартные параметры.
Рекомендуемый порядок действий, если вы видите “не установлен файл настроек конфигурации”
| Порядок | Что сделать | Ожидаемый результат |
|---|---|---|
| 1 | Открыть протокол проверки ini-файлов и посмотреть текст ошибки | будет понятно, на каком этапе “не проходит” настройка |
| 2 | Включить Автообновление в «Настройки/Файлы настроек» | обработка берёт актуальные XML под вашу версию |
| 3 | Запустить Проверка настроек | ошибки исчезают |
| 4 | Если не исчезло - выбрать вариант конфигурации из списка и создать новое подключение настроек | подтягиваются нужные файлы, включая настройку конфигурации |
| 5 | Если конфигурация доработана - применить пользовательские настройки (user файл) или обновить настройки вручную | проверка становится успешной |
Куда смотреть, если всё равно не получается
Если после обновления и проверки в протоколе остаются ошибки, обычно помогает только разбор по вашей конкретной связке: версия 1С + какой конфигурационный набор выбрался + полный протокол проверки.
СБИС прямо рекомендует:
- сохранить протокол,
- передать в техподдержку,
- приложить данные по вашей конфигурации 1С.
Источники
- Saby (wiki): что такое файлы файл настроек и как устроены типы
ВО82<Код конфигурации>_Конфигурация.sbis3.xmlи наборы выгрузки/загрузки: https://saby.ru/help/integration/1C_set/modul/api/struct - Saby (help): причины ошибок проверки ini-файлов и что делать при несовпадении версий/обновлении 1С: https://saby.ru/help/integration/1C_set/modul/protokol
- Статья с практическими шагами “ошибка при открытии внешней обработки СБИС, не найден справочник/ini” через автообновление и проверку настроек: https://nastroyka-1c.ru/2021/07/oshibka-pri-otkryitii-obrabotki-sbis-ne-najden-spravochnik-nomenklatura-postavshhikov/